AGENCY: Bountiful (Utah)

SERIES: 84861
TITLE: Special improvement bonds
DATES: s 1967.
ARRANGEMENT: none

DESCRIPTION: Bonds are sold to fund a specific municipal improvement or building project. The governing body of the municipality levies the assessment based on an ordinance or resolution. To obtain a bond, bids are received and reviewed. The bonds are sold at a set price and mature within a given time period as they accrue interest. Information includes state, county and city that issues the bond; series number and date; amount of the bond; legal stipulations and rate per annum; and the mayor and city recorder's signatures. The debt must apply to projects within the lawful limits of the city according to law.
